diff options
| -rw-r--r-- | doRelease.go | 7 | ||||
| -rw-r--r-- | releaseWindow.go | 10 |
2 files changed, 14 insertions, 3 deletions
diff --git a/doRelease.go b/doRelease.go index 2ff444f..98687f3 100644 --- a/doRelease.go +++ b/doRelease.go @@ -109,7 +109,12 @@ func doRelease() bool { return false } release.current.status.CheckSafeGoSumRemake() - release.current.status.MakeRedomod() + if release.current.status.MakeRedomod() { + log.Info("Redo mod ok") + } else { + log.Info("go mod tidy not ok") + return false + } if ok, _ := release.current.status.CheckGoSum(); ok { log.Info("repo has go.sum requirements that are clean") // release.current.setGoSumStatus("CLEAN") diff --git a/releaseWindow.go b/releaseWindow.go index 9a93c3e..863178f 100644 --- a/releaseWindow.go +++ b/releaseWindow.go @@ -221,7 +221,10 @@ func createReleaseBox(box *gui.Node) { release.makeRedomodB = release.grid.NewButton("make redomod", func() { buttonDisable() - release.current.status.MakeRedomod() + if release.current.status.MakeRedomod() { + } else { + log.Info("This is bad. stop here") + } buttonEnable() }) @@ -256,7 +259,10 @@ func createReleaseBox(box *gui.Node) { func fullDoubleCheckFix() bool { release.current.status.CheckSafeGoSumRemake() - release.current.status.MakeRedomod() + if ! release.current.status.MakeRedomod() { + log.Info("go mod failed") + return false + } if ok, _ := release.current.status.CheckGoSum(); ok { log.Info("go.sum is clean") } else { |
